Single ply roof inspection services involve a thorough assessment of these types of roofing systems to identify potential issues before they develop into costly problems. During an inspection, service providers examine the roof’s surface for signs of damage, such as tears, punctures, or blisters, and check the integrity of seams and flashings. They also evaluate the condition of the membrane for signs of deterioration, curling, or cracking. This process helps ensure that the roof remains watertight and performs as intended, providing homeowners with peace of mind and a clear understanding of their roof’s current state.
These inspections are particularly useful for identifying common problems like leaks, ponding water, or membrane damage that can compromise the roof’s effectiveness. Over time, exposure to weather elements can cause wear and tear, leading to small issues that might not be immediately visible but can escalate if left unaddressed. Regular inspections can help catch these issues early, allowing for timely repairs that extend the lifespan of the roof and prevent more extensive damage to the property’s interior and structure.

Small Repairs - typical costs for minor inspections or small repairs on single ply roofs range from $250-$600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, covering areas like patching small leaks or checking membrane integrity.
Moderate Projects - larger inspections or repairs involving moderate surface area typically cost between $600-$1,500. These projects are common for mid-sized commercial or residential roofs needing detailed assessments.
Major Repairs - extensive repairs or partial restorations can range from $1,500-$3,500, depending on the complexity and size of the roof. Fewer projects reach this tier, often involving significant membrane repairs or leak mitigation.
Full Roof Replacement - complete replacement services generally start around $5,000 and can exceed $15,000 for larger, more complex projects. Local contractors may provide detailed estimates based on roof size, material, and scope of work.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is involved in a single ply roof inspection? A professional inspection typically includes examining the membrane for signs of damage, checking seams and flashing, and assessing overall roof condition to identify potential issues.
Why should I have my single ply roof inspected regularly? Regular inspections help detect early signs of wear or damage, which can prevent costly repairs and extend the lifespan of the roof.
How do local contractors perform single ply roof inspections? Local service providers conduct thorough visual assessments, sometimes using specialized tools to evaluate the roof’s integrity and identify areas needing attention.
What signs indicate my single ply roof might need an inspection? Visible issues like cracks, blisters, ponding water, or seam separations suggest it’s time to have a professional inspection performed.
Can a single ply roof inspection help prevent future leaks? Yes, by identifying potential vulnerabilities early, inspections can help address problems before they develop into leaks or more significant damage.
